WM Technology, Inc. is a leading provider of digital solutions for the cannabis industry, serving retailers and brands across the United States, Canada, and international markets. At its core is the Weedmaps platform, a widely used online marketplace that empowers cannabis consumers to effortlessly discover and explore a vast array of products from various retailers and brands, and facilitates local product reservations. Beyond shopping, Weedmaps also serves as a valuable resource, offering comprehensive information on the cannabis plant, industry insights, and advocating for legalization…

WM Technology NASDAQ: MAPS stockholders did not approve a proposal to amend the company's certificate of incorporation to declassify its board of directors and move to the immediate annual election of all directors, according to preliminary results announced during the company's 2026 Annual Meeting of Stockholders.
